Job Description:

ACCOUNTABILITIES:

  • Consistently demonstrates empathy and concern for clients/families.
  • Provides emergency food referrals to clients as directed by caseworkers or Community Services Director
  • Assists in maintaining client files and statistical records and keeps track of volunteer’s hours
  • Performs general office duties such as answers telephone calls and directs and answers inquiries; greets and escort visitors; opens mail, files documents electronically or manually; photocopies and distributes materials as requested; sends and receives fax/email material as requested; resolves routine inquiries.
  • Handles and ensures the protection of extremely confidential and sensitive employee/Officer, client and/or program files.
  • Assists in submitting the Biweekly payroll information.
  • Gives oversight of the reconciliation of staff corporate visas and personal expenses through Business World for timely payment.
  • Opens and distributes incoming mail and process outgoing mail including materials of a confidential nature.
  • May order stationery supplies and assist in maintaining adequate office supplies/other supplies as needed, may arrange for maintenance of office equipment.
  • Prepares and receives paperwork for various projects and programs as assigned by Supervisor or Department Lead - month-end and year-end tasks, including reports and journal entries and other business-related projects and tasks as needed
  • Types and/or updates forms, letters, reports, and memos, assuring typing accuracy.
  • Draft and prepares presentations, brochures, flyers, invitations, etc. subject to Supervisor’s direction and approval.
  • Responsible for maintaining inventories, and updating as needed. Basic building oversight in partnership with the ministry unit leaders, ensuring issues are noted, reported to the right service provider, and addressed in a timely manner.
  • Handles walk-in donations, and issue temporary receipts and prepares official tax receipts.
  • Receives and/or declines, sorts, organizes donated or purchased product as directed and in accordance with standard procedures
  • May be required to handle hazardous material in a safe and conscientious manner with WHMIS and Worksafe guidelines.
  • Arranges for disposal of unusable items in accordance with policy
  • Gives direction to volunteers assigned to administrative duties
  • Assists in scheduling meetings, may be required to draft agenda, take minutes and distribute minutes accordingly.
  • Performs other job-related duties as assigned.

CRITICAL RELATIONSHIP MANAGEMENT

Governance Boards and Councils: None

Internal: Corps Officer, Directors, clients, all staff and volunteers

External: General public, donors

MANAGERIAL/TECHNICAL LEADERSHIP RESPONSIBILITY :

  • The incumbent will not have any formal management responsibility.
  • They may show and direct volunteers how to perform certain duties

FINANCIAL AND MATERIALS MANAGEMENT:

  • The incumbent has minor material responsibilities occasionally receiving and ensuring the effective usage of materials
  • Uses or maintains organization assets in accordance with established guidelines.
  • Does not process any financial transactions with no budget responsibilities.

WORKING CONDITIONS:

The incumbent’s work environment is typically in a general office setting. The incumbent works in generally agreeable conditions, with the following exceptions:

  • Dealing with angry people
  • Verbal abuse
  • Frequent interruptions and multitasking
  • Temperature variations (i.e., front door opening and closing)
  • Equipment and general office noise (i.e., people talking, phones ringing)
